列如何使用MSSQL设置唯一性标识列(mssql 设置标识)
mssql 使用 如何 设置 标识 唯一性
2023-06-13 09:18:46 时间
注册唯一性标识列是MS SQL Server 数据库的一个必需项,可以帮助您跟踪数据库中唯一的行,下面我们就来看下如何使用MSSQL设置唯一性标识列。
### 一、方法
#### 1.1 用T-SQL脚本设置
您可以使用T-SQL脚本在MS SQL Server数据库中创建表并在其中设置唯一性标识列:
`sql
CREATE TABLE MyTable (
ID int identity (1,1) not null, 自动增长初始值为1
Column1 varchar (50),
Column2 varchar (50)
)
ALTER TABLE MyTable
ADD CONSTRAINT pk_MyTable PRIMARY KEY (id) 主键ID
此脚本创建一个表MyTable,并设置id列为主键,从而在表中添加唯一标识列。在此表中,我们使用Identity()函数为Id列提供自动增长字段。
#### 1.2 通过GUI设置
除了使用T-SQL脚本,您也可以使用MS SQL Server管理器工具来创建表并设置唯一性标识列:
a) 首先,在MS SQL Server管理器中,打开新的查询窗口,在窗口中输入以下内容,使用Create Table语句创建新的表:
```sqlCreate Table MyTable (
ID int primary key, Column1 varchar (50),
Column2 varchar (50))
b) 然后 ,单击“文件”菜单,选择“保存MyTable ”菜单,将查询结果另存为一个文件。
c) 下一步,单击新创建的MyTable文件,转到“设计”视图,选择ID列,右键点击ID列,在弹出菜单中选择“设置为主键”,选中“标识”复选框,从下拉列表选择“自动增长”,然后点击确定进行设置。
d) 最后,单击“查询”菜单,编辑并执行脚本以创建表:
`sql
CREATE TABLE MyTable (
ID int identity (1,1) not null, 自动增长初始值为1
Column1 varchar (50),
Column2 varchar (50)
)
ALTER TABLE MyTable
ADD CONSTRAINT pk_MyTable PRIMARY KEY (id) 主键ID
e) 创建完成后,唯一性标识列就会出现在表中。
### 二、总结
通过以上的步骤,我们可以特别容易地使用MSSQL设置唯一性标识列。唯一性标识列是MS SQL Server 数据库中不可或缺的一项,可以有效的帮助我们跟踪数据库中的唯一的行。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 列如何使用MSSQL设置唯一性标识列(mssql 设置标识)
相关文章
- 如何使用MSSQL快速创建索引(mssql建索引)
- 蓝鸟飞翔,连接MSSQL数据库(蓝鸟连接mssql)
- 服务禁止局域网内MSSQL服务的通告(禁止局域网mssql)
- 结构如何从MSSQL中导出表结构(怎么导出mssql表)
- 如何导入MSSQL数据结构?(导入mssql数据和结构)
- 使用PDO MSSQL驱动来操作MSSQL数据库(pdo mssql驱动)
- MSSQL中重建视图以恢复数据可视性(mssql 重建视图)
- MSSQL连接数据库出现异常:失败的挑战(mssql连接数据库失败)
- 如何将MSSQL连接到PostgreSQL数据库(mssql连pg数据库)
- 数据MSSQL如何有效地过滤掉重复数据(mssql过滤掉重复)
- 利用 MSSQL 跟踪和优化数据库性能(mssql 跟踪数据库)
- MSSQL数据库如何读取最新数据(mssql 读取最新数据)
- 使用MSSQL设置提升服务器性能的最大连接数(mssql设置最大连接数)
- MSSQL表ID重置:新生活新希望(mssql表id重排)
- MSSQL简单操作:编写查询代码(mssql简单的查询代码)
- MSSQL使用游标遍历表的简单实现(mssql游标遍历表)
- MSSQL数据库如何清除字段(mssql 清除字段)
- MSSQL 如何添加索引有效提升查询效率(mssql 添加索引)
- MSSQL注册表路径探索之旅(mssql注册表路径)
- 使用MSSQL查询表字段的技巧(mssql 查询表字段)
- MSSQL 合并查询聚合强大处理能力(mssql 查询合并)
- 远程使用MSSQL管理工具极大提升效率(远程mssql管理工具)
- MSSQL中如何表收缩空间(表收缩空间-mssql)